Solar and the feed-in tariff in Southport

691 installations are accredited under the Feed-in Tariff here, holding 2,837 kW of capacity. That ranks the constituency 487 of 633 and accounts for 0.08% of every FIT installation in the country.

When they went up

Like most of the country, Southport front-loaded: the busiest year was 2011, before the tariff cuts began to bite.
